Transaction 1fc419625f7d640178042feb77175171b0c2985c1ff23e29d6077e47802469a8
1 Input
2 Outputs
- 1fc419625f7d640178042feb77175171b0c2985c1ff23e29d6077e47802469a8:0
- 1fc419625f7d640178042feb77175171b0c2985c1ff23e29d6077e47802469a8:1
value 626685734
address 13hyTD6DwZcsJe8Su1CkcC2mzAVH5Z3BvF
value 1605323
address 1HW5dT1p5caZtxmWAhYjGB1bnmCfpykRKe